Dundee Venture Capital

Dundee Venture Capital, established in 2010, is a venture capital firm headquartered in Omaha, Nebraska, with additional offices in Chicago, Minneapolis, and Saint Louis. The firm specializes in investing in early-stage technology companies, focusing on B2B SaaS, e-commerce, fintech, and supply chain technology sectors. Dundee typically invests between $0.25 million to $1 million in initial rounds, with a potential follow-on investment, and seeks board positions or observer roles. The firm's investment focus is on underserved capital markets across the United States, with a typical exit timeline of six to eight years. Dundee Venture Capital does not invest in companies requiring government approval for operation, such as those in bio, pharma, or life sciences sectors.

SightLine Partners

SightLine Partners is an investment firm based in Bloomington, Minnesota, with an additional office in Palo Alto, California. Founded in 2004, it concentrates on healthcare investments across the United States, including medical technology, medical devices, diagnostics, biotechnology, and healthcare services. The firm targets later-stage and growth opportunities, investing in private companies through preferred stock typically between $2 million and $8 million, with an expected exit within about five years. Its focus includes therapeutic areas such as vascular diseases, diabetes, neurology, cardiovascular and orthopedic care, oncology, and infectious disease, as well as senior care, home healthcare, specialty facilities, ancillary and alternate-site services, and healthcare outsourcing. The firm seeks US-based opportunities in late-stage and expansion ventures within healthcare, life sciences, and related sectors.

Yukon Partners

Founded in 2008, Yukon Partners is a Minneapolis-based mezzanine firm specializing in investments ranging from $10 million to $50 million. It focuses on middle market companies with EBITDA between $5 million and $50 million and revenues up to $500 million, typically controlled by private equity sponsors. The firm invests through secured-debt, subordinated debt, minority common equity, and preferred stock, targeting sectors such as healthcare, automotive, consumer products, industrial manufacturing, and business services.

Clearwater Equity Group

Clearwater Equity Group is a private equity firm established in 1997 and located in Minneapolis, Minnesota, with an additional office in Saint Louis Park. The firm specializes in acquiring profitable lower middle market and middle market companies, focusing on partnerships with management teams. Clearwater Equity Group typically invests between $2 million and $5 million in its portfolio companies, targeting those with EBITDA of up to $5 million. The firm structures its investments through a combination of equity and subordinated debt, seeking ownership stakes ranging from 10 percent to 100 percent, which allows for both majority and minority interests in the businesses it acquires. Notably, Clearwater Equity Group invests its own capital and does not manage external funds.
